Gynecological Inflammation Immunofluorescence Staining Solution Market Regional Analysis, Demand Analysis and Competitive Outlook 2025-2032

Market Overview

MARKET INSIGHTS

Global Gynecological Inflammation Immunofluorescence Staining Solution market was valued at USD 449 million in 2024. The market is projected to grow from USD 476 million in 2025 to USD 667 million by 2031, exhibiting a CAGR of 6.0% during the forecast period.

Gynecological inflammation immunofluorescence staining solutions are specialized diagnostic reagents used for the rapid and accurate identification of pathogens causing vaginitis and other inflammatory conditions. These solutions utilize antibody-fluorophore conjugates that bind to specific antigens from organisms like Candida albicans, Gardnerella, and Trichomonas vaginalis, making them visible under a fluorescence microscope. This technology is critical for diagnosis because vaginitis affects an estimated three out of every four women of childbearing age at least once, with 40% to 50% experiencing recurrent infections.

The market is experiencing steady growth primarily due to the high global prevalence of gynecological inflammatory diseases and the increasing clinical demand for rapid, point-of-care diagnostic tests that outperform traditional microscopy and culture methods. Furthermore, ongoing technological advancements that improve the sensitivity and specificity of these immunoassays are contributing to market expansion. The competitive landscape includes key players such as Hologic, Inc. and Dezhou Guoke Medical Technology Co., Ltd., who are focused on expanding their product portfolios to capture greater market share in both established and emerging regions.

MARKET DRIVERS


Rising Incidence of Gynecological Infections

The global increase in the prevalence of gynecological inflammatory conditions, such as bacterial vaginosis, vulvovaginal candidiasis, and sexually transmitted infections, is a primary driver for the immunofluorescence staining solution market. The growing global female population in the reproductive age group contributes significantly to the patient pool, necessitating accurate diagnostic tools. The high sensitivity and specificity of immunofluorescence (IF) staining for detecting specific pathogens and inflammatory markers in cervical and vaginal samples are key factors propelling demand in clinical diagnostics.

Advancements in Diagnostic Technologies

Technological progress in automated staining systems and multiplex immunofluorescence assays is enhancing the efficiency and throughput of gynecological testing. These solutions allow for the simultaneous detection of multiple pathogens from a single sample, reducing turnaround time and improving workflow in diagnostic laboratories. The integration of digital pathology and image analysis software with IF staining is further driving adoption by enabling quantitative and reproducible results, which are crucial for both diagnosis and research applications.

The shift towards personalized medicine and point-of-care testing is creating new avenues for rapid, specific diagnostic solutions in women's health.

Growing awareness about women's health and the importance of early diagnosis is also a significant driver. Increased healthcare spending and government initiatives aimed at improving reproductive health services in emerging economies are making advanced diagnostic tools more accessible, thereby expanding the market for specialized staining solutions.

MARKET CHALLENGES


High Cost and Complexity of Assays

Immunofluorescence staining solutions require sophisticated instrumentation, specialized reagents, and trained personnel, leading to high overall costs. This can be a barrier to adoption, particularly in resource-limited settings and smaller diagnostic labs. The technical complexity of the staining procedure, including sample preparation and interpretation of results, necessitates continuous training and quality control, posing operational challenges.

Other Challenges

Regulatory Hurdles and Validation
Obtaining regulatory approvals for new immunofluorescence staining kits involves rigorous clinical validation to demonstrate accuracy and reproducibility. The varying regulatory landscapes across different countries can delay market entry and increase development costs for manufacturers.

Competition from Alternative Technologies
Immunofluorescence staining faces competition from other diagnostic methods, such as PCR-based tests and newer molecular techniques, which may offer faster results or higher throughput for certain applications, challenging the market share of IF solutions.

MARKET RESTRAINTS


Limited Reimbursement Policies

In many healthcare systems, reimbursement for advanced diagnostic tests like immunofluorescence staining is not fully established or is limited to specific indications. This can discourage healthcare providers from adopting these tests routinely, particularly in cost-sensitive markets. The lack of standardized reimbursement codes for multiplex IF assays in gynecological diagnostics further restrains market growth.

Stringent Storage and Handling Requirements

Immunofluorescence reagents often require strict cold chain management and have limited shelf lives, increasing logistical challenges and costs for distributors and end-users. This can be a significant restraint in regions with underdeveloped infrastructure, limiting the geographical reach of these products.

By Technology
  • Direct Immunofluorescence
  • Indirect Immunofluorescence
  • Multiplex Assays
Direct Immunofluorescence is the leading technological segment, favored for its rapid turnaround time, simplified protocol, and high specificity in detecting antigens directly from patient samples. This method's efficiency is critical in clinical diagnostics for fast and accurate identification of gynecological pathogens, supporting timely treatment decisions. The technique's robustness and lower requirement for complex instrumentation make it highly accessible for routine use in diagnostic settings, cementing its position as the preferred choice over more time-consuming or technically demanding alternatives.

North America
North America stands as the undisputed leader in the Gynecological Inflammation Immunofluorescence Staining Solution market, primarily driven by the high adoption rate of advanced diagnostic technologies, well-established healthcare infrastructure, and significant investment in women's health research. The region benefits from a strong presence of key market players who continuously innovate to develop more precise and automated staining solutions for diagnosing conditions like vaginitis, cervicitis, and pelvic inflammatory disease. High awareness levels among healthcare providers and patients regarding early and accurate diagnosis of gynecological infections fuel market growth. Favorable reimbursement policies and stringent regulatory frameworks ensure the availability of high-quality, reliable diagnostic kits. Collaborative efforts between academic research institutions and diagnostic companies further accelerate the development and validation of novel immunofluorescence assays, solidifying North America's pioneering role in this specialized diagnostic segment.
